Relating to the authority to request attorney general advice on questions relating to actions in which the state is interested.
No significant fiscal implication to the State is anticipated.
SB 1339 would permit an attorney who serves as the head of the civil legal department for a county on the Mexican border with less than 400,000 people and one or more cities with more than 200,000 people to seek a written opinion from the Attorney General on an action to which the state is a party. This attorney would have to receive approval for the request from their county commissioner's court.
